That's right, Ted Levine, the chilling actor behind *Silence of the Lambs*' infamous Buffalo Bill, has finally broken his silence on his character's controversial portrayal of gender identity, admitting profound regret. While he originally saw Buffalo Bill as simply a "screwed-up straight man" during filming, Levine now confesses he's had a complete change of heart. After working with trans individuals and gaining a deeper understanding, he firmly believes the film "vilified" the trans community. Even producer Edward Saxon is echoing these sentiments, confessing the filmmakers regrettably lacked sensitivity to stereotypes, despite not intending malice at the time. They genuinely believed Buffalo Bill was just a "sick individual" with an "aberrant personality," not a representation of the trans community. This admission re-ignites a decades-old debate, forcing Hollywood to confront how iconic characters can inadvertently cause harm.
